A head's up to anyone in the Seattle/WA area next weekend May 7th and 7th is the NorthWest Paddling Festival at Lake Sammamish state park. This is an awesome opportunity to try a ton of different boats, attend some clinics, and just talk paddling and fishing with like minded folks.

 If you are looking at getting into the sport, I can't stress how important it is to demo as many different brands and models as possible is before you drop some hard earned coin. Events like this are great because you can walk down the beach and try everything side by side.

The weather was amazing last year, hopefully it is again this year.

Friday, May 6: 2:00 p.m. – 7:00 p.m.
Saturday, May 7: 9:00 a.m. – 5:00 p.m.
